Abstract

This article examines the technology of cheese production in the dairy industry in the context of waste-free technologies. The results of the study showed that increasing the level of whey and curd processing provides environmental and economic efficiency. Membrane filtration and biogas production methods allow for the effective use of waste in dairy production. The introduction of waste-free technologies improves the quality of dairy products and reduces production costs. The widespread use of such technologies in the dairy industry of Kazakhstan will contribute to environmental sustainability and economic development in the future.
